Deep Learning Side-Channel Attacks for Rolled Architecture of PRINCE and Midori128 Shu Takemoto, Yoshiya Ikezaki, Yusuke Nozaki, Masaya Yoshikawa (Meijo Univ.) AI2022-3 |

| (in English) |
With the recent expansion of small autonomous mobile robots such as drones, cyber security for small devices is very important. PRINCE and Midori128 have been proposed as typical low-power block ciphers for small devices. On the other hand, side-channel attacks have been reported to illegally analyze secret keys by using power consumption during cryptographic device operation. As the accuracy of deep neural networks improves, the technology is also being used in the security field. Deep Learning Side-Channel Attack (DL-SCA), a method for efficiently analyzing side-channel attacks using deep learning, has been proposed. For secure implementation of PRINCE and Midori128, it is important to evaluate tamper-resistance to DL-SCA. Therefore, This study evaluates the tamper-resistance of DL-SCA for PRINCE and Midori128, which are loop architecture implementations on Field Programmable Gate Array (FPGA). |
